How to draw a monkey easy step by step

Step 1

Draw an ellipse (it doesn’t have to be perfect).

Step 2

Draw a heart or number 3. Two small bumps or cheekbones.

Step 3

Next draw a rough circle for the head.

Step 4

Draw two ears.

Step 5

Now for the facial details. Draw two smaller ear shapes inside the ears. A pair of eyes. An ellipse or rounded nose. And a line for the mouth.

Step 6

Draw a circle below the head for the body.

Step 7

And one inside the first one.

Step 8

Draw the limbs.

Step 9

And ending with the hands and the tail,

Step 10

Color your monkey drawing.
